Are There Other Legal And Financial Considerations

Contracts: You may be asked to sign one or more contracts with the recipient. IVF1 does not require egg donors or egg recipients to sign outside legal contracts. Egg donors will sign a document stating that from the time the eggs are removed from her ovaries that they become the property of the recipient couple.

Confidentiality: During this process, we will gather a great deal of information about you from your application and throughout the screening process. This information will be given to potential recipients of your eggs. If you are donating anonymously, the recipient will not be given your name or any information that can be used to identify you. You can obtain copies of any of your medical information. This can be done directly through the patient portal on our website. Alternatively, you can fill out a document called a record release form to receive a printed copy of your medical records. This process is the same as for any patient.

Currently, there are no laws in Illinois that require disclosure of the identity of an egg donor for any reason. However, it is possible that confidentiality laws and regulations may change in the future. For example, there are currently attempts underway to pass laws to allow children who were given up for adoption to obtain their birth certificates. In addition, we cannot guarantee that someone will not discover confidential information by unauthorized means.

Residential Kitchens Home Bakers Exemption

However, there is also a Home Baking Bill that exemptsresidential kitchens for certain baked goods & confectionary items. The HomeBakery Exemption allows people to produce certain baked goods andconfectionary items in their home kitchens and sell them directly toconsumers without having to obtain a food establishment license orundergo an inspection from the Oregon Department of Agriculture. Exempt home kitchens must be built and maintained in a clean,healthful, and sanitary manner.

Residential Kitchens may be exempt if producing baked goods orconfectionery items that are not potentially hazardous and that aresold only to the end user. Sales must not exceed $20,000 annually.

Anyone who would like to sell food that is made in his or herhome kitchen that does not meet the Home Bakery Exemptions mustobtain and meet all special requirements for a domestic kitchenbakery and/or food processing license. These licenses start at $152per year and $189 per year respectively:

Egg Grading And Size Before Selling Eggs

PE

The egg industry has defined what is acceptable to the public in the size and shape of eggs, and many consumers believe that all eggs are precisely the same.

Anything different is frowned upon and considered inferior we know differently, though!Industry eggs are graded, and for the most part, only grade AA eggs make it to the supermarket for general consumption.

Grade A is considered acceptable but of lower quality.

Grade B are eggs that may have stains, irregular shape, or shell quality.

These are sent to foodstuff manufacturers. B eggs are not sold to the general public because they dont measure up to the industry standard.The size and weight of eggs are generally divided into six categories:

  • Peewee 1.25 oz
  • Extra-large 2.25oz

You do not have to grade or size your eggs unless you intend to sell them commercially.

Farmgate sales are exempt from grading.

Also, you do not have to fill the carton with eggs of the same size. For instance, you can vary the size with two large, two medium, and two small.

Where May Cottage Food Production Operations Sell The Food Products

Foods prepared under the Home Bakery Exemption may only be soldby the producer directly to the consumer at the producer’s home,farmers’ markets, farm stands, roadside stands and similar venues.You cannot sell goods produced under the Home Bakery Exemption to acommercial entity or an institution including, but not limited to, arestaurant, grocery store, caterer, school, day care center,hospital, nursing home, or correctional facility

How Does The Egg Donation Process Go

Different clinics have different processes, but in general, they follow similar steps like this:

  • Fill out and send an egg donor application Most application forms will ask about personal stuff , followed by your medical history. Wait for an invitation.
  • The clinic invites you back for some tests and interviews In the clinic, potential donors would have to undergo physical tests, ovarian function tests, psychological tests, drug tests, and other types of medical and psychological exams. The screenings can take six to eight weeks to complete.
  • The clinic lets you know whether theyve approved your application and whether theyve matched you to a recipient At this stage, youll also be informed of the next steps, your legal rights, how to self-administer your medications, and what you can and cant do while youre under medication .
  • You start medication. First, you stop your menstrual cycle. On the third week, you self-inject with a drug to reduce sex hormones, then a drug to stimulate multiple follicles to produce eggs, and then a final injection of follicle-stimulating hormone so that you ovulate on a specific date.
  • Eggs are retrieved from the donor. On the date of your ovulation, your eggs are harvested while youre under IV sedation. This step only takes 20 minutes.
  • Go back to the clinic. Youll be having post-retrieval checkups at the clinic, including a sonogram and a psych evaluation.

    Cost Of Selling Chicken Eggs

    Umpqua Flashtail Mini Egg Oregon Cheese Fly Fishing Eggs Size 16

    Thanks to this growing love for organic or humane products, you already have an existing market that you can reach with your chicken eggs. So how do you decide on the price?

    You should start by considering the upkeep. How much does it cost to look after your chickens? Think of the price of housing, water, electricity, feed, etc. Then, compare with the average supermarket price. You can likely charge a bit more than your local supermarket does.

    That being said, other factors could influence the price of your chicken eggs such as the availability in your local area. If you live in a town, people may be willing to spend more as they view it as a rare product.

    In contrast, if you live rurally where there are many people selling their own chicken eggs then you might need to charge slightly less in order to make sales. You can always include a delivery service or subscription if you want to entice people to pay more.

    You might want to offer a discount for bulk purchases or charge more during the winter when fresh eggs are more scarce.

    Will The Recipient Know Who I Am

    At IVF1, we keep the identity of donors and the recipients confidential . However, it is very likely that at some point, the recipients or their children will learn your identity. New technologies such as facial recognition are now widely available. DNA testing services such as 23andMe and AncestryDNA can identify a persons relatives from a large database. This is true even if you have never used those services. If a relative of yours has used these services then it can be used to find your identity.
